Use "ancient" to describe things that existed or happened a very long time ago, often thousands of years in the past. It can refer to civilizations, artifacts, or periods of history. For example, "ancient Egypt" or "ancient ruins." It can also be used more generally for something that is extremely old or outdated, such as "ancient technology" or "an ancient tradition."
A common mistake is using "ancient" for something that is simply old but not from the very distant past. For instance, a car from the 1950s might be considered old, but it's not typically described as "ancient." Also, ensure you are using it as an adjective; for example, you wouldn't say "the ancient of a civilization," but rather "the ancient civilization."

10 个问题Ancient generally refers to things from a very distant past, often thousands of years ago (like ancient civilizations). Old is a more general term that can describe anything that has existed for a long time, whether it's a few years or many centuries.
While you could technically say someone is 'ancient' if they are extremely old, it's not a common or very polite way to describe a person. We usually use it for objects, places, or time periods. For people, you might say 'very old' or 'elderly'.
Not quite! Ancient typically refers to things from a time in the very distant past (thousands of years). Antique usually refers to items that are old, often 100 years or more, and are valued for their age and craftsmanship, like antique furniture or jewelry.
Sometimes. While it often implies historical significance or a sense of awe, it can also suggest something is outdated, primitive, or no longer relevant. For example, 'ancient technology' might imply it's no longer useful.
You'll often hear phrases like 'ancient history' (referring to a very long time ago), 'ancient civilizations' (like Ancient Egypt or Rome), 'ancient ruins' (very old buildings), or 'ancient traditions'.
Yes, it can be! You can talk about 'ancient beliefs', 'ancient customs', or 'ancient wisdom'. These are not physical objects but still refer to something from a very distant past.
Some good synonyms for 'ancient' depend on the context. You could use 'archaic', 'primitive', 'prehistoric', or 'age-old'. If you mean something simply very old, 'old' or 'very old' works too.
You might hear it used playfully or sarcastically. For example, someone might say 'These rules are ancient!' to mean they are very outdated, even if they weren't literally established thousands of years ago. But this is an informal use.
CEFR A2 indicates that 'ancient' is considered a basic-level vocabulary word. This means learners at an A2 level should be able to understand and use 'ancient' in simple sentences and common contexts.
The pronunciation is AYN-shunt. The 'ci' sounds like 'sh'.

The Silk Road was an ancient network of trade routes that connected the East and West, stretching from China to the Mediterranean Sea. For over 1,500 years, it facilitated the exchange of goods, ideas, and cultures between vastly different civilizations. While primarily known for silk, many other products like spices, precious metals, and technologies also traveled along these ancient pathways, profoundly shaping the course of human history.

The concept of 'ancient forests' often conjures images of untouched wilderness, pristine and primeval. However, many so-called ancient forests in Europe and Asia bear the subtle, yet discernible, marks of human activity extending back millennia. These landscapes, though appearing wild, have been shaped by ancient agricultural practices, forestry management, and even spiritual rituals. Understanding this anthropogenic influence is vital for truly appreciating their ecological complexity and for developing effective conservation strategies that acknowledge their unique historical trajectory.

The decipherment of ancient scripts, such as Egyptian hieroglyphs or Mesopotamian cuneiform, represented monumental intellectual achievements. These breakthroughs not only unlocked vast stores of historical, religious, and literary knowledge but also fundamentally altered our understanding of human civilization's origins and trajectory. The meticulous work of linguists and archaeologists in piecing together these fragments of the past continues to illuminate the complex tapestry of ancient societies, revealing intricate social structures, advanced astronomical observations, and sophisticated legal codes that often predate their European counterparts by millennia.
